The fact that a European used Japanese vocals doesn't make a track Japanese. We don't have shit in the way of good music out here, Tomiie aside. Mostly Club DJ's, that still spin 9PM and Sandstorm. There's a few good ones out there, but none with CD or vinyl releases outside Japan.

Hey Thornael, the name of that track is called " Inner Universe" Off the Ghost in Shell Stand Alone Complex OST, took me a while to find, I love this thing now, by
Yoko Kanno/Origa/Shanti Snyder
